Listed below are the steps to view the mobile version of a website on Chrome:
- Open DevTools by pressing F12.
- Click on the “Device Toggle Toolbar” available. (
- Choose a device you want to simulate from the list of iOS and Android devices.
- Once the desired device is chosen, it displays the mobile view of the website.
How does my site look on different devices?
Open your site in a Chrome incognito window. Right-click anywhere on the page and click “Inspect”. Click the “Responsive” drop-down menu above your site content. From there, you can choose different devices to view how the current page appears on each one, and note areas you want to spruce up.

How do I get mobile site on iPhone?
Tap on the Tabs button in Safari and then close that webpages tab while it’s still in Desktop Site view (optionally, you may want to copy the URL first for easy retrieval) Now open a new Safari tab and go back to the website URL you just closed, it will load automatically in Mobile Site view.

How to Request Desktop Site on Safari iPhone or iPad?
- Launch the Safari browser app on iPhone or iPad.
- Open the Website URL that you want to request a desktop website.
- Tap on the AA icon within the URL bar.
- From the available list, select the Request Desktop Website option.

How to Perform Mobile Website Testing
- Launch Chrome and navigate to the website to be tested on mobile.
- Open the Developer Tools available in Settings -> More Tools -> Developer Tools.
- Select the Device Toggle Bar.
- Select the device to be emulated from the available list of Android and iOS devices.

Why does my website look different on mobile?
If your website shows up as a really small version of its regular self on your phone, chances are, a mobile version of the site doesn’t exist. So, when it can’t find a mobile version, it looks at the whole thing as a desktop computer would. Then, it automatically shrinks it down to fit your screen.

How to View Mobile Responsive Site in Safari Mac?
- Launch the Safari browser on a Mac computer.
- Open the website that you want in the mobile site view.
- Click on the Develop menu for options.
- Select the Enter Responsive Design Mode option from the drop-down.
How do I view desktop site on mobile Safari?
Open the Safari app on your iPhone or iPad and load a website. Now, tap and hold on the “Refresh” button next to the URL bar. You’ll see a popup at the bottom of the screen. From here, select “Request Desktop Site.”
